The Mercury Lynx Wagon is a compact station wagon from 1984, offering practicality in a small package. It features a 2.0L diesel engine and a manual 5-speed transmission, making it a fuel-efficient option for city driving or longer trips. With its wagon design, it provides extra cargo space while maintaining a manageable size.
